Hand-welted and Goodyear-welted shoes are often discussed as if one must be authentic and the other compromised. That is not a useful way to compare them. Both are proven welted construction systems, and both can produce excellent shoes.

What they share

In both systems, a welt helps create a connection between the upper/insole structure and the outsole. The outsole is stitched to the welt rather than being permanently bonded directly to the upper. That architecture is one reason welted shoes are commonly associated with repairability.

What changes in Goodyear welting

In conventional Goodyear-welted construction, a machine stitches the welt to a rib associated with the insole. The method was developed to mechanize a labor-intensive part of traditional welted shoemaking while preserving the useful two-stage welt-and-outsole relationship.

What changes in hand welting

In hand welting, the inseaming work is performed manually. The shoemaker prepares the insole for the stitch and hand-sews the welt, upper and insole relationship rather than using the Goodyear welt-sewing machine.

That requires time and skill, and it creates room for a craftsperson to control the inseam directly. But it does not mean every hand-welted shoe is automatically better than every Goodyear-welted shoe.

Does one last longer?

There is no responsible fixed lifespan to quote. Wear pattern, moisture, rotation, leather condition, sole material, welt condition and repair quality all affect service life. A well-made shoe from either system can be maintained for years; a neglected or badly fitting shoe can fail much sooner.

Does hand welting fit better?

The welt stitch itself does not determine fit. Last shape, width, pattern, lasting and upper material matter more directly. Hand-welted shoes are often found in higher-touch production contexts where hand lasting and individualized finishing may also be present, but those are separate operations.

Do not pay for a construction label while ignoring fit. A beautifully executed welt on the wrong last is still the wrong shoe.

What are you actually paying for?

With hand welting, part of the premium is the skilled manual labor involved in preparing and sewing the inseam. With high-quality Goodyear construction, you are paying for materials, factory skill, process control, finishing and a repair-oriented structure that can be produced more efficiently.

Which should you choose?

Choose based on the whole product. If you value the manual craft and the maker executes it well, hand welting can be meaningful. If a Goodyear-welted shoe fits better, uses the leather you prefer and is finished to a high standard, the fact that a machine performed the welt stitch should not disqualify it.

The hidden difference: how the inseam is created

The most meaningful technical difference sits inside the shoe. Standard Goodyear welting uses a prepared rib associated with the insole and a specialized welt-sewing machine. Traditional hand welting prepares the insole so the shoemaker can make the inseam manually. The outsole can then be stitched to the welt in either system.

Why Goodyear welting became important

Mechanizing the inseaming operation made welted footwear more repeatable and scalable while preserving the two-stage architecture that allows the outsole to be separated from the upper more readily for repair. That is why high-quality ready-to-wear makers have relied on Goodyear construction for generations.

Why hand welting still matters

Hand welting preserves a highly skilled manual operation and allows the craftsperson direct control over the prepared insole and inseam. For buyers who value labor-intensive shoemaking, provenance and traditional technique, that can be a meaningful part of the product rather than just a performance metric.

Weight, flexibility and break-in

People often generalize that one construction is always lighter, more flexible or more comfortable. In practice, insole thickness, welt size, sole stack, filling, last and upper materials can outweigh the construction label. Compare the actual pair, not a forum stereotype.

Repair implications

Both systems are commonly chosen because the outsole can be replaced without stitching through the upper in the same way as a direct Blake stitch. The condition of the welt and insole still matters. A repairer may sometimes replace or repair the welt, but the feasibility depends on the shoe.

Value: where the premium should show

If a hand-welted shoe costs more, the premium should be visible in more than the words “hand welted.” Look for clean lasting, controlled inseaming, good clicking, appropriate leather, balanced heel work and disciplined finishing. Craft value comes from execution.
